Why is Eswatini a risky importer of electricity?
Eswatini is a net importer of electricity, which poses a risk for energy secu-rity. Electricity prices vary greatly, with much of the variabil-ity reflecting the relative ease of energy supply and the extent to which electricity prices are subject to government control.
What are the sources of primary energy supply in Eswatini?
Sources of total primary energy supply (TPES) in Eswatini in-clude hard coal, renewables and waste, hydropower, electricity and petroleum.
What is the trend for the Eswatini energy system?
The overall trend for the Eswatini energy system is clear: de-pendency on electricity imports will remain above 50 % in total electricity production to about 2019, then gradually decrease until 2034 to less than 10 %.

What is the electricity access rate in Eswatini?
In 2014 the national electricity access rate (i. e., the share of households with electricity access) was 65 %, with the urban rate being 84 % and the rural household rate being 60 %. Rural electrification continues to be a priority issue in Eswatini.

Micro Inverters

Micro inverters offer a unique advantage in solar power systems. Unlike traditional string inverters, each micro inverter is connected to a single solar panel, allowing for individual panel optimization. This means that even if one panel is shaded or has a lower performance due to some reason, it won't affect the overall output of the entire system. They are easy to install, highly efficient in converting DC to AC power, and provide better flexibility in system design, making them suitable for both residential and small commercial solar installations.

Get Price →Kingdom of Eswatini | SACREEE Community
The utility has four hydro power stations: Edwaleni (15 MW), Maguga (20MW), Ezulwini (20MW) and Maguduza (5.6MW). In addition to this, there is about 105 MW installed capacity of predominantly bagasse and wood chips biomass private sector power plants which largely provide captive power captive power. and is primarily for own use.
